    Martinsville Speedway President Clay Campbell presents (from left) Pfc. Albert Boston, a human resources clerk for Headquarters and Headquarters Detachment, 2nd Battalion, 3rd Special Forces Group, Sgt. Chase Noble, a mechanic for Company E, 1st Battalion, 508th Parachutist Infantry Regiment, 4th Brigade Combat Team, 82nd Airborne Division, Spc. Mathew McClintock, an infantryman for Headquarters and Headquarters Company, 1st Battalion, 508th Parachutist Infantry Regiment, 4th Brigade Combat Team, 82nd Airborne Division, and Sgt. Chad Willis, a finance clerk for 18th Finance Company, 1st Theater Support Command, with a Grand Marshals statue at the Tums Fast Relief 500 NASCAR race at Martinsville Speedway Oct. 28. As grand marshals the four Fort Bragg Soldiers officially started the race. (Photo by Army Sgt. Joshua Tucker/ 50th Public Affairs Detachment).
